2. Control
The pursuit of power in street and drift racing often raises the question of control. While 300whp offers a significant boost in performance, it also demands careful consideration of the car’s handling and braking systems. Maintaining control at this power level requires a comprehensive approach that encompasses various aspects of the vehicle’s dynamics.
- Suspension Tuning: Upgrading the suspension system is crucial for enhancing the car’s handling capabilities at 300whp. Stiffer springs and adjustable dampers allow drivers to fine-tune the car’s ride height, cornering balance, and overall stability. Proper suspension tuning ensures the car remains composed and predictable, even under hard cornering and sudden maneuvers.
- Upgraded Brakes: With increased power comes the need for more stopping power. Upgrading the brakes with larger rotors, high-performance pads, and stainless steel brake lines is essential for maintaining control at 300whp. These upgrades improve the car’s ability to decelerate quickly and efficiently, reducing stopping distances and enhancing overall safety.
- Performance Tires: Performance tires play a vital role in transferring the car’s power to the road and providing grip during cornering and acceleration. Tires with a wider contact patch and higher grip levels are recommended for 300whp applications. These tires enhance the car’s stability, traction, and cornering abilities, allowing drivers to push the limits with confidence.
By addressing these aspects of control, drivers can harness the full potential of 300whp while maintaining a safe and predictable driving experience. Proper suspension tuning, upgraded brakes, and performance tires work in conjunction to ensure the car remains composed and responsive, allowing drivers to explore the limits of their vehicles and enjoy the exhilaration of street and drift racing.

Question 2: What modifications are necessary to achieve 300 whp?
Reaching 300 whp typically requires a combination of engine performance enhancements, such as turbocharger or supercharger upgrades, exhaust system modifications, and engine management tuning. Other supporting modifications may include upgraded fuel systems, intercoolers, and drivetrain components to handle the increased power output.
Question 3: Is it possible to achieve 300 whp on a naturally aspirated engine?
Achieving 300 whp on a naturally aspirated engine is challenging but not impossible. It requires extensive engine modifications, such as high-compression pistons, aggressive camshafts, and optimized intake and exhaust systems. However, forced induction methods like turbocharging or supercharging are generally more effective in reaching this power level.

Tips for Achieving Optimal Street/Drift Performance at 300 whp
Harnessing the full potential of a 300 whp car for street and drift applications requires a combination of technical expertise and skillful driving techniques. Here are several crucial tips to optimize performance and safety:
Tip 1: Maximize Traction with Performance Tires: Enhance grip and stability by equipping the car with high-performance tires specifically designed for street and drift driving. Wider tires with aggressive tread patterns provide increased contact surface area, resulting in improved traction during acceleration, braking, and cornering.
Tip 2: Optimize Suspension Setup for Handling: Ensure precise handling and control by fine-tuning the car’s suspension system. Adjustable coilovers allow for customization of ride height, spring rates, and damping characteristics. Proper setup optimizes the car’s weight distribution and reduces body roll, enhancing cornering ability and overall stability.
Tip 3: Upgrade Braking System for Enhanced Stopping Power: To match the increased power output, upgrade the braking system with larger rotors, high-performance pads, and stainless steel brake lines. These upgrades improve the car’s ability to decelerate quickly and efficiently, reducing stopping distances and providing greater control, especially during spirited driving or emergency situations.
Tip 4: Implement a Limited-Slip Differential for Improved Power Delivery: Enhance traction and control, particularly during drift maneuvers, by installing a limited-slip differential (LSD). An LSD allows the wheels on the same axle to rotate at different speeds, providing better power distribution and reducing wheel slip.
Tip 5: Prioritize Safety with a Roll Cage and Harness: For added safety in high-performance driving situations, consider installing a roll cage and racing harness. A roll cage strengthens the car’s structure, providing protection in the event of an accident. A racing harness keeps the driver securely in place, minimizing the risk of injury during sudden maneuvers or impacts.
Tip 6: Enhance Driver Skills Through Practice and Training: Mastering the art of high-performance driving requires practice and training. Attend driving schools or participate in track events to develop car control skills, learn advanced techniques, and improve overall driving proficiency.
